Topics Covered
- Fundamentals of AI and Machine Learning: Introduction to key concepts and algorithms in AI and machine learning.
- IoT Sensor Data Fundamentals: Understanding the basics of IoT sensors and the data they generate.
- Data Preprocessing and Feature Engineering: Techniques for cleaning, transforming, and extracting features from sensor data.
- AI Models for Sensor Data Processing: Designing and implementing AI models tailored for IoT sensor data.
- Real-Time Data Processing and Analytics: Methods for processing and analyzing sensor data in real-time.
- Ethical and Privacy Considerations in AI for IoT: Exploring the ethical implications and privacy concerns in AI-driven IoT systems.
